
A delightful and surprisingly easy snack featuring grilled Jersey cream cakes, topped with a fragrant honey-lavender glaze. Perfect for a summer afternoon treat!
Preheat your grill to medium heat. Lightly grease the grates with cooking oil spray or brush with oil to prevent sticking.
Brush both sides of the Jersey cream cakes with melted butter.
Place the buttered cakes on the preheated grill. Grill for 2-3 minutes per side, or until golden brown and slightly warmed through, leaving grill marks.
While the cakes are grilling, prepare the honey-lavender glaze. In a small saucepan, combine honey, heavy cream, and crushed lavender buds.
Heat the glaze over low heat, stirring constantly, until the honey is thinned and the lavender is fragrant (about 2-3 minutes). Do not boil.
Remove the glaze from heat and stir in vanilla extract (if using) and a pinch of sea salt.
Remove the grilled cakes from the grill and place them on serving plates.
Drizzle the honey-lavender glaze generously over the grilled Jersey cream cakes.
Serve immediately and enjoy!

For a more intense lavender flavor, infuse the honey with lavender buds for a few hours before making the glaze. Strain the honey before using.
If you don't have a grill, you can use a grill pan on the stovetop or bake the cakes in a 350°F oven for 5-7 minutes until warmed through.
Garnish with fresh berries or edible flowers for an extra touch of elegance.
Adjust the amount of lavender in the glaze to suit your taste. Start with a small amount and add more as needed.
